Quick Answer: To achieve a 100/100 Google PageSpeed score with LiteSpeed Cache (LSCache), enable Guest Mode and Guest Optimization, turn on CSS/JS Minification and Combine, configure Unique CSS (UCSS) with Critical CSS generation, enable JS Delay (Load JS Deferred), and connect a Redis Object Cache database socket.
Why LiteSpeed Cache Outperforms Standard PHP Caching Plugins
Unlike Apache or Nginx caching plugins (such as WP Super Cache or W3 Total Cache) that must execute PHP to check cache rules, LiteSpeed Cache (LSCache) communicates directly with the web server kernel. OpenLiteSpeed and LiteSpeed Enterprise intercept incoming HTTP requests and serve static, pre-rendered HTML snapshots from memory in under 30 milliseconds with zero PHP-FPM execution.
Step 1: Enabling Guest Mode and Guest Optimization
Guest Mode is LiteSpeed’s flagship speed feature for first-time visitors and Googlebot crawlers. Navigate to LiteSpeed Cache > General > Guest Mode and toggle both settings to ON:
- Guest Mode: Delivers an ultra-lightweight static page for all non-logged-in visitors immediately upon first landing.
- Guest Optimization: Injects inline Critical CSS, converts images to WebP/AVIF, and defers non-critical JavaScript before client-side hydration.
Step 2: Page Optimization (CSS, JS & HTML Tuning)
In LiteSpeed Cache > Page Optimization, configure these high-performance options:
CSS Settings:
- CSS Minify: ON
- CSS Combine: OFF (With HTTP/2 and HTTP/3, multiplexing individual minified files is faster than massive combined stylesheets).
- Generate Critical CSS: ON
- Unique CSS (UCSS): ON (Removes unused CSS per-page automatically via QUIC.cloud).
JS Settings:
- JS Minify: ON
- JS Combine: OFF
- Load JS Deferred: Deferred
- Load Inline JS: Deferred
Step 3: Image Optimization & WebP Delivery
Under LiteSpeed Cache > Image Optimization > Image Optimization Settings:
- Auto Request Cron: ON
- Auto Pull Cron: ON
- Create WebP Versions: ON
- Image WebP Replacement: ON
Step 4: Connecting Redis / Memcached Object Cache
Object caching stores complex database query results in RAM. Under LiteSpeed Cache > Cache > [6] Object:
# Object Cache Configuration Object Cache: ON Method: Redis Host: 127.0.0.1 Port: 6379 Persistent Connection: ON Cache WP-Admin: OFF

Optimizing Core Web Vitals: Largest Contentful Paint (LCP) & CLS
Achieving a green score in Google Search Console requires optimizing both LCP and Cumulative Layout Shift (CLS):
- Exclude Hero Images from Lazy Loading: Under LiteSpeed Cache > Page Optimization > Media Settings, set Lazy Load Image Excludes to your featured image class or specify
1for Lazy Load Image Skip Number to ensure your hero banner renders instantly. - Add Missing Explicit Width/Height Attributes: Enable Add Missing Sizes in LSCache Media settings to prevent browser layout shifts as images download, maintaining CLS below 0.05.
- Font Display Swap: Under Localization, enable
font-display: swapto eliminate Flash of Invisible Text (FOIT) during font loading.
Advanced LSCache Tuning for WooCommerce & Dynamic Stores
For eCommerce stores, configure ESI (Edge Side Includes) in LiteSpeed Cache to cache 95% of the static product page while punching dynamic micro-holes for the customer cart widget, login status, and personalized checkout tokens.
Fine-Tuning LSCache Browser Cache and Cache-Control Headers
In addition to server-side page caching, configure aggressive browser caching in LiteSpeed Cache > Cache > [3] Browser to instruct client devices to store static images, fonts, and stylesheets locally in memory for up to 1 year:
# Recommended Browser Cache TTL Settings Browser Cache: ON Browser Cache TTL: 31536000 (1 Year in seconds)
This ensures repeat visitors experience instantaneous sub-10ms page navigation as all layout assets are loaded directly from local browser storage without making external network requests.
Resolving Common CSS/JS Optimization Glitches in LiteSpeed Cache
- Broken Sliders or Sticky Menus: If sliders fail to initialize after enabling JS optimization, add their script handle or inline snippet to JS Deferred / Delayed Excludes.
- Font Awesome Icon Displaying as Empty Squares: Under Page Optimization > Font Settings, toggle Load Google Fonts Asynchronously to
ONand enable Font Display Default toswap. - High Disk Usage in Cache Directory: If your
lscachefolder consumes excessive storage, decrease your default cache TTL to 86,400 seconds (24 hours) and enable Auto Purge on Post Update.

Frequently Asked Questions
Why does my site look broken after enabling CSS Combine?
Combining CSS files alters CSS cascade priority. Leave CSS Combine OFF and rely on Unique CSS (UCSS) and Critical CSS for safe Core Web Vitals optimization.
